Transaction 5eb6c31083ef4d17113190c258a1a33a324a4d08eb09d142541a4dcbd6eea029
1 Input
1 Output
-
5eb6c31083ef4d17113190c258a1a33a324a4d08eb09d142541a4dcbd6eea029:0
- value
- 66136
- script pubkey
- OP_0 OP_PUSHBYTES_20 659e4617b77dacb1f8e5867e37d72ed97fb186fd
- address
- bc1qvk0yv9ah0kktr789selr04ewm9lmrphafz7ese